Output 17cec623c56647ddab88578b12bb4669ded0372f852505be8c289d130570b71f:0

value
100637030
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dd854f89310f3f821025a4a6d2788b8bebcd1b4 OP_EQUALVERIFY OP_CHECKSIG
address
LY9xhGPzbh5eNYx3gQwcF5QRTzYqEPWAxq
transaction
17cec623c56647ddab88578b12bb4669ded0372f852505be8c289d130570b71f
spent
true